Wolves stump Stratton

Staff

The Sight & Sound Wolves again showed some resiliency, bouncing back after a loss to improve their Rainy River District Fastball League record to 3-2.
The Wolves continued their pattern of alternating wins and losses with a 4-1 victory over visiting Stratton at VanJura Park here last night.
Bob Andy picked up the victory while Guy Arpin suffered the loss for Stratton (2-4).
In other RRDFL action, the Big Grassy Lightning kept Big Island out of the win column with a 19-1 thumping.
Chris Jack, Jeff Morrison, and Randy Morrison all belted home runs while Jeff Morrison picked up the win for the Lightning (4-2).
Rueben Gibbins was on the mound for 0-7 Big Island.
Elsewhere, Sabaskong dumped Manitou 9-2 on the strength of two homers by Don Copenace, who also got the win for the Cubs (5-1).
Aaron Pitchenese pitched for Manitou, who fell to 2-4.
Meanwhile, Rainy River’s offence continued to struggle as the Royals suffered their third-straight shutout—this time 3-0 to the Barwick Blue Knights.
George Oltsher picked up the win for Barwick (6-1) while Murray Armstrong again was the hard-luck loser for Rainy River (2-3).
Lastly, the Big Grassy Braves topped Northwest Bay 12-8.
Travis Tom got the win for the Braves (4-2) while Terry Smith was tagged with the loss for Northwest Bay (2-4).
